WebInformation. Stem erect, branched, 3–5 ft. high, terete, more or less white-cottony, not glandular. Stem-leaves sessile, ovate, pinnatisect, 2–8 in. long; segments spinous-incised or undivided. Heads about 3/4 in. long or including the long spines that project from some of them about 1 3/8 in. long, crowded in clusters of 3–4 in. diameter. 'White Globe' is an erect, clump-forming, deciduous perennial, with deeply lobed, dark grey-green, thistle-like leaves, and white, branched, leafy stems bearing spherical, white flower heads in late summer.
